Importance of Fibonacci Retracement Levels

The second contributing factor to the convergence is the Fibonacci retracement level. Traders utilize Fibonacci retracement levels to identify potential areas of support or resistance based on the natural ratio derived from the Fibonacci sequence. These levels act as significant price zones where price reversals or bounces may occur. The convergence of USD/JPY with a Fibonacci retracement level adds another layer of technical significance to the pair’s current positioning.

Additionally, the third element contributing to the convergence is the horizontal support level. Horizontal support levels are created by identifying areas on the price chart where significant buying interest has historically been observed. When price approaches these levels, traders anticipate potential support and a possible rebound in price. The convergence of USD/JPY with a horizontal support level enhances the technical significance of this confluence.
